
Home Depot offers FREE Kids workshops the first Saturday of every month from 9:00 AM to 12:00PM. It is a great way to bond, learn new skills and build your child's confidence. They will feel so accomplished with their craft, FREE certificate of
achievement, a Workshop Apron, and a commemorative pin. This is available to all kids between 5 and 12 years old. All of this is available while supplies

How To Attend a Home Depot Kids Workshop
Click the Register button and local your local Home Depot by using the Find Store button. Select the store you'd like to take your child to and choose the workshop day and time.
To finish the registration, you'll need to fill out your name, email
address, number of kids attending and their names and birthdays.

Limitations
The Home Depot Kids Workshop is for children ages 5-12. An adult will
need to stay with the child during the entirety of the Home Depot Kids
Workshop.
The project kits are only available while supplies last.
